Upon arriving in Cartagena, we were headed to our first hotel located near the Sierra Nevada de Santa Marta. We wanted to stay near Tayrona National Park so we could get there early in the mornings. We arranged a taxi through our hotel. The driver was waiting for us as soon as we landed in Cartagena. We loaded up the car and started the 4 hour drive to our first hotel. The drive was pleasant but definitely felt long. At one point, we got stuck in a traffic jam that lasted for 45 minutes. No cars could move so people started getting out of their vehicles and began hanging out in the street. We did as the locals did!

IMG_2309_opt

Our driver was nice enough to stop along the way so that Andrew could get a Colombian sim card. We do not speak much Spanish so this would have been difficult without his guidance. There are plenty of rest stops along the way so it was no problem using the restroom or getting more snacks. I enjoyed observing Colombia via car during this drive. We finally arrived to our hotel as the sun was setting.
